What Are Energy-Saving Windows?
Energy-saving windows, likewise understood as energy-efficient windows, are designed to lessen heat loss in the winter and keep indoor areas cooler during the summer season. These windows are constructed using advanced materials and technologies that boost their thermal efficiency, allowing them to decrease energy usage for cooling and heating.

Picking the ideal energy-saving windows for your home involves understanding the various types available on the marketplace. Here's a detailed comparison of the most common options:
Window Installation TypeDescriptionProsConsDouble PaneInclude 2 glass panes with an insulating space in between.Exceptional thermal insulation; extensively available.Typically heavier; might be more pricey than single-pane.Triple PaneThree glass panes with 2 insulating areas.Superior insulation; great for extreme climates.Much heavier and more expensive than double-pane; might require more powerful frames.Low-E GlassFunctions a thin finish to reflect heat while allowing light to enter.Improves efficiency; preserves natural light.Can be more pricey upfront.Gas-FilledWindows filled with inert gas (like argon or krypton) for included insulation.Excellent thermal performance; reduces heat transfer.Higher installation expenses; needs Professional Window Installation installation.Smart WindowsAdaptive glass that can change its tint based on temperature level or sunlight.Optimizes energy effectiveness; improves comfort.Very expensive; technological considerations for replacement.Elements to Consider When Choosing Energy-Saving Windows

On average, house owners can conserve in between 10% and 50% on their energy costs after installing energy-efficient windows, depending upon their home's insulation and local climate.
Q2: What is the life-span of energy-saving windows?
Energy-saving windows can last anywhere from 20 to 40 years with appropriate maintenance. Factors such as ecological exposure and frame products can influence sturdiness.
Q3: Are energy-saving windows worth the preliminary investment?
While energy-saving windows may cost more in advance, they typically spend for themselves over time through decreased energy costs, increased comfort, and possible tax credits or rebates.
